ASICS GEL-NIMBUS 261011B794 400 Description: GEL-NIMBUS 26 running shoes are designed to provide the user with as much comfort as possible while running, so that they can enjoy peace of mind. The maximum level of cushioning allows you to run even further and enjoy comfort. In this footwear model, our new PureGEL technology is combined with soft FF BLAST PLUS ECO foam. This means you'll experience exceptional comfort whenever you want to run even further. Moreover, the improved construction of the upper and collar provides a feeling of unrivaled comfort and fit. What makes the GEL-NIMBUS 26 running shoes so comfortable? The innovative PureGEL technology means more softness and better shock absorption, reducing the load on your joints and making you run with a feeling of complete comfort. FF BLAST PLUS ECO foam ensures softer landings and better shock absorption, which translates into comfortable running on harder surfaces. The airy upper and collar provide a feeling of unrivaled comfort and fit. What else distinguishes GEL-NIMBUS 26 footwear? These footwear are designed with user comfort in mind. We spent many hours testing and perfecting it at our Institute of Sports Sciences (ISS) in Japan. GEL-NIMBUS 26 running shoes are equipped with additional technical solutions that support the user while running. You'll learn more about them in the "Technical Specifications and Features" section below. Neutral Foot type Normal arch size Push-off Weight distribution on the front of the foot is even. How the foot contacts the ground First, the outer part of the heel contacts the ground, then the foot rolls inward (pronation) to absorb shock and support the body weight. Supination Foot type High arch Push-off Pressure is placed on the smaller toes on the outside of the foot. How the foot contacts the ground The outside of the heel strikes the ground at an increased angle with little or no normal pronation, causing a lot of shock transfer to the lower leg. Technology and features: PureGEL technology Provides more softness and better shock absorption to reduce stress on joints. FF BLAST PLUS ECO foam Helps ensure the highest comfort. Improved upper design Provides superior comfort with easier entry and an unrivaled fit. Hybrid ASICSGRIP sole Helps improve traction and provides advanced durability. OrthoLite X-55 insert Provides additional comfort and improves moisture management. A specially designed stretch knit upper hugs the foot for additional support and improves breathability to keep feet cool while running for increased comfort. Small reflective elements Increase visibility in low light conditions. Designed with the environment in mind At least 75% of the main upper consists of recycled materials. We also used less water and reduced carbon dioxide emissions in the production of the insert. Better for you, better for the environment. Sole height difference (heel-toe drop) Details: Drop: 8 mm Weight: 304 g
